THE culture at the "failing" health board responsible for a scandal-hit super-hospital is "rotten", it was claimed yesterday.
First Minister Humza Yousaf was urged to condemn the actions of NHS Greater Glasgow and Clyde (NHSGGC) which runs the Queen Elizabeth University Hospital.
Scottish Labour leader Anas Sarwar challenged Yousaf "to do the right thing" and sack the board.
Sarwar called the board's actions "disgusting" after the Record revealed a communications director was alleged to have told her staff a concerned parent "won't win the war" after he raised concerns in the media.
A whistleblower, who we agreed not to name, said Sandra C Bustillo made the remark more than once after Professor John Cuddihy spoke publicly about his daughter Molly's case
Cancer patient Molly fell ill at the Queen Elizabeth University Hospital campus and went into septic shock - a life-threatening condition which happens when blood pressure drops to a dangerously low level after an infection.
Molly was diagnosed with mycobacterium chelonae, an infection in her line which came from the hospital environment.
